What is the purpose of a smart device?

Purpose Of Smart Devices

In recent years, smart devices have become increasingly popular among health and fitness enthusiasts. These devices, which include fitness trackers, smartwatches, and other wearable technology, are designed to help people track their physical activity, monitor their health, and improve their overall wellbeing. In this article, we will explore the benefits of wearable devices for personal health and wellness, and how they can help you track your way to better health.

Smart devices have become increasingly popular in recent years, with many people using them as a tool to track and monitor their physical activity and overall health. From fitness trackers to smartwatches, wearable technology has revolutionized the way we approach health and wellness. Here are some of the main benefits of using wearable devices to track your health.


1. Increased Physical Activity: Smart devices can encourage you to move more by setting daily step goals, tracking your progress, and sending reminders to stay active. This can help improve cardiovascular health, reduce the risk of chronic diseases, and boost mood and energy levels.

2. Improved Sleep Quality: Many smart devices also contain sleep tracking features, allowing you to monitor your sleep patterns and identify any problems or disruptions. By understanding your sleep habits better, you can make small changes that improve your sleep quality.

3. Enhanced Productivity: Smart devices can help improve productivity by tracking your work breaks, reminding you to take breaks, and keeping track of your daily agenda. Some devices can also provide insights into how you spend your time and help you manage your schedule more effectively.

4.Better Health Management: Smart devices can also offer valuable insights into your overall health status. By tracking health metrics like heart rate, blood pressure, and calories burned, you can identify potential health issues early on and make lifestyle changes to improve your overall health.

5. Motivation and Accountability: Tracking your health progress with a Smart device can provide motivation and accountability, as it allows you to monitor and track your progress over time. This can be particularly helpful for those trying to make lifestyle changes or reach specific health goals.

6. Data Sharing: Smart devices can also facilitate data sharing between individuals and healthcare providers. By sharing data from wearable devices, healthcare providers can gain a better understanding of an individual's health and provide more personalized care.

Overall, smart devices have the potential to be an essential tool for better health management and personal wellness. By providing personalized insights and motivation to move more, sleep better, and improve overall health, wearable devices can help you achieve a healthier and happier lifestyle. 

However, it's important to note that smart devices are not a substitute for professional medical advice and care. While they can provide valuable insights into personal health and wellness, individuals should always consult with a healthcare provider for any medical concerns or conditions.
